Medical Treatment
When a boating incident results in severe injuries, the medical costs can quickly become overwhelming. These bills are usually paid for in part by a victim's health insurance. The victim may be faced with high coinsurance, deductibles, costs, and lost wages because of absence from work. Additionally non-economic damages, like pain, suffering or loss of enjoyment of living, could be a factor.
An experienced lawyer can aid victims in obtaining the financial compensation they are entitled to. They will look into the facts and determine who is responsible for the accident. This can include subpoenaing witnesses and the collection of evidence to discover the root of the accident.
It is crucial for injured victims to seek medical attention right away following a boating accident. This ensures that any serious injuries are treated and documented correctly. Medical records can also be used to support an insurance claim.
It is also vital for injured victims to report the accident to their insurance company. This is especially the case if the victim owned or operated the vessel involved in the incident. Insurance companies will ask for details such as names, contact details, registration or identification number of all boat owners and witnesses. The lawyer will also require documentation including photos and visible damage.
Documentation
It's important to remember that just as you would in a car crash you can seek reimbursement for medical expenses and other losses following a boating accident. The amount you may receive can be used to cover a range of expenses such as medical visits, Xrays, physical therapy and prescriptions and also loss of income due to being incapable of working.
It's a good idea to take pictures of the accident scene as well as any visible injuries. Also, it's a good idea to gather the contact information of witnesses as well as anyone on any of the vessels involved in the crash. This will help you construct your case in the event that you're required to file a lawsuit against a negligent person.
In an injury lawsuit, there are four elements that you must prove: that the defendant was bound by the duty of care to you, they breached this duty, that their breach caused you to suffer injury and damages and that your injuries and damages were the result of the incident. In a case of a boating collision you can identify multiple defendants responsible for your boating accident, depending on their level of negligence and the role they played in the incident.
While it's important to obtain as much documentation as possible after a boating accident but you shouldn't offer an apology or take responsibility for the accident. This could impede the investigation process and could affect your claim for injuries sustained from boating.
Insurance Coverage
With easy access to the Atlantic Ocean and numerous lakes it is commonplace for New Yorkers to enjoy boating and similar water activities. This activity is a recreational one that comes with unique liabilities that should be considered seriously. If you are injured in an accident on the water it is recommended to work with an experienced personal injury attorney.
An attorney could help you determine the insurance coverage available for your case. The majority of boat owners and operators carry liability insurance to cover damages caused by them. However when the other party is not insured or underinsured, you may be eligible for additional compensation via an excess policy.
Check your boat insurance policy to ensure it's current and covers you for your boat. These policies will usually cover medical expenses, which includes hospital bills, first aid treatments and other related expenses, if you or anyone else who is on board suffers injury while on your vessel. The policies also typically include a towing policy that provides for on-site labor and towing expenses in the amount you choose if your boat becomes disabled on the water.
According to the policy physical damage coverage can be included in the policy the agreed value loss settlement, which covers you for the full amount of the policy in total loss circumstances or the actual cash value coverage that pays for the current market price of your columbiana boat accident attorney, less depreciation. Certain policies also provide coverage for pollution (spills) and pet insurance and wreck removal.
